“…The image analysis represents a non-invasive and cost-effective procedure to reproduce the saturation profile under dynamic condition. Generally, the non-intrusive or nondestructive methods used to measure fluid saturation, such as gamma ray [2,3,13,21], or conventional X-ray attenuation techniques [22][23][24], do not allow the acquisition of dynamic fluid saturation distribution in the entire flow domain at one time. Because of practical limitations on source intensity, long counting times are needed and only one point can be measured at one time [25].…”
